Hi and welcome to YT. So glad you could join us. Looks like you may be a grandma soon. ;) I just hope there will be no complications. Just go ahead and make up a whelping box for her to get used to. Usually the day of birth, the mom is very restless and pants a lot. Sometimes not eating, but drinking a lot of water. This is the time to keep a very close eye on her. Don't let her outside unless your with her, and make sure she can't get under anything outside where you couldn't reach her. If you do, then put her harness and leash on each time you take her out. If you will pm me your location in Kentucky, I might be able to help you out. My vet is small town and rural but he can feel the babies at about thirty days. He does not believe in X-rays but will if I insist. I found a wonderful vet about an hour away from me that does ultrasounds at 28 days and x-rays a few days before delivery. The drive is worth it to me and the cost is very reasonable. Sooooooooo, where in Ky are you. |
